" One bed fourth floor purpose built retirment flat with lift, private south facing balcony with sea views, uPVC double glazing, white bathroom suite and offered with no chain.

ENTRANCE After taking the Communal Staircase or Lift to the Fourth Floor Landing Level there is a solid door opening through to: ENTRANCE HALLWAY Doors lead through to the Living Room, Bedroom, Shower Room/W.C and a further door to one side opens into a built-in storage cupboard housing the electric fuse box and hot water cylinder. LIVING ROOM 17'3 x 10'6 Approx. 17' 3 x 10' 6. uPVC double glazed window overlooking the rear with door leading out onto a small balcony. T.V and telephone point and archway leading through to the Kitchen. BALCONY A South facing balcony overlooking the beautiful communal gardens with far reaching sea views beyond. KITCHEN 7'3 x 6'0 Approx. 7' 3 x 6' 0. An internal room fitted to three sides with a roll edge work surface, matching range of wall and base units, stainless steel sink/drainer, 4 ring electric hob with electric oven under and extractor fan over, space to one side for a free standing fridge/freezer, ceramic tiled splashbacks. BEDROOM 14'3 x 9'0 Approx. 14' 3 x 9' 0. uPVC double glazed tilt and turn window overlooking the communal rear gardens with sea views beyond. Wall mounted electric night storage radiator and two bi-folding mirrored doors open into a built-in storage cupboard with hanging rail and shelving over. SHOWER ROOM/W.C. 6'8 x 5'9 Approx. 6' 8 x 5' 9. An internal room fitted with a white suite comprising of a low level W.C, wash hand basin set into a vanity unit with mirrored medicine cabinet over, a double shower cubicle with wall mounted electric shower with extractor fan and wall mounted towel rail radiator and extensively ceramic tiled walls. COMMUNAL FACILITIES RESIDENTS LOUNGE Situated on the ground floor at the rear of the building with doors leading onto the communal Clifton Gardens at the rear, there is a dance floor area and on occassions a licensed bar. LAUNDRY ROOM There are communal laundry rooms and facilities at either end of the building where use of the appliances is free of charge to the residents. The appliances are provided and serviced through the maintenance fund. GUEST SUITE Two suites comprising of a bedroom and a bathroom are available for guests of the residents to book the use of. A nominal pay is for the use of this facility and is collected by the House Manager. 24 HOUR EMERGENCY CALL SYSTEM There is a 24 hour emergency call system fitted within the flat with call buttons/pull cords located in all principal rooms. This system is connect to the House Managers alarm system during working hours and to a 24 hour call service system out of hours. OUTSIDE We have not seen the deeds to the property and prospective buyers are therefore advised to verify boundaries through their legal advisors. COMMUNAL GARDENS To either side and to the rear of the block is an extensive lawned parkland garden area which is for the use of the residents. PARKING There are residents parking spaces available subject to allocation by the House Manager dependant upon availability. In addition to residents parking, visitors parking is also available. GENERAL INFORMATION Prospective buyers are advised to verify details of the Lease and Service Charge accounts through their legal advisors. LENGTH OF LEASE We have been advised by our client that the Length of Lease is 139 years from September 1983 with approx 106 years now remaining. GROUND RENT We have been advised by our client that the Ground Rent is currently ?441.62 MAINTENANCE We have been advised by our client that the Maintenance Charges are currently ?2,177.51. AGENTS NOTE We have been advised by the managing agent that there is an age restriction of 60 years or over placed on all buyers of apartments within Homepine House. COUNCIL TAX We have checked with the VOA website for the council tax band for this property on 2nd November 2015, and can advise that it is listed as council tax band B. We would ask you to consider that Council Tax bandings may be subject to change by the Listing Officer. For further details, please contact Shepway District Council on 01303 853000. "
